
Balsamic Roasted Vegetables with Rosemary, Artichokes & Zucchini

Serve these Balsamic Roasted Vegetables alongside roasted chicken or pot roast. Easy, healthy and delicious.

Ingredients
- 2 medium zucchini about 1 pound, cut into 1-inch thick rounds
- 2 medium yellow squashes about 1 pound, cut into 1-inch thick rounds
- 1 red bell pepper cut into 1-inch pieces
- 1 large yellow onion cut into 1-inch pieces, with root left intact
- 1 can 14 ounce artichoke hearts (packed in water), cut in half
- ½ teaspoon kosher salt
- ½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- ¼ cup liquid from artichoke can
- ¼ cup balsamic vinegar
- 1 tablespoon canola oil
- 1 tablespoon chopped fresh rosemary

Instructions
- Preheat oven to 475 degrees F. Lightly coat a large baking sheet with cooking spray.
- In a large bowl, combine zucchini, yellow squash, red bell pepper, onion and artichoke hearts.
- Toss gently with salt and pepper.
- Pour in artichoke liquid, balsamic vinegar, canola oil and rosemary. Toss again to coat the vegetables.
- Spread the vegetables in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et.
- Roast the vegetables until tender, turning occasionally, until tender, about 25 to 30 minutes.
- Serve warm or at room temperature.
